Retired Courses - by College/School

Course Number:
ISY G265
Credit Hours:
4
Course Title:
Enterprise Systems Architecture and Engineering
Course Description:
Extends the rudiments of C and Unix covered in ISY G200. Geared for students who want to explore the Unix operating system and deepen their understanding of the fundamentals of Unix. Topics include popular Unix tools and programs (vi, emacs, pipes, grep, and so on); Unix system calls (fork, exec, read, and write); introduction to Unix shells and scripting; static and dynamic libraries; use of make files; and software engineering project management from the perspective of the system developer. Requires a major term project using coding with advanced C/Unix techniques.
